Tom Kaulitz Net Worth: How Much Is the Tokio Hotel Star Worth?

Tom Kaulitz is a German musician, songwriter, and producer best known as the lead guitarist of the band Tokio Hotel. His creative work and high-profile public presence have generated consistent interest in his financial standing, with many fans and media outlets curious about Tom Kaulitz net worth.

Beyond his music catalog and royalties, his ventures in brand partnerships, live performances, and production work contribute to a complex picture of his overall wealth. This article breaks down the key components that shape his estimated net worth and how he has built long-term value in the entertainment industry.

Musical Legacy and Catalog Value

Tom Kaulitz net worth is heavily anchored in the success of Tokio Hotel, a band that defined an era of German pop-rock. The group’s catalog continues to generate substantial streaming revenue, with older tracks maintaining strong listener engagement on digital platforms.

Beyond streaming, rights management plays a critical role. Mechanical royalties, public performance royalties, and synchronization licensing for film, TV, and advertising ensure that the back catalog remains a reliable income source over time.

Touring Revenue and Live Performance Economics

Live performances have been one of the most significant drivers of Tom Kaulitz net worth, especially during peak Tokio Hotel tours. Large arena shows and festival bookings command substantial fees and provide consistent cash flow.

Tour economics include not only ticket splits but also merchandise, VIP experiences, and hospitality packages. These ancillary revenue streams amplify the financial impact of each major tour cycle.

Brand Endorsements and Production Ventures

Strategic brand partnerships have expanded Tom Kaulitz net worth beyond traditional music income. Endorsement deals with instrument makers, audio brands, and lifestyle companies provide upfront payments and ongoing ambassador fees.

His involvement in production work, including studio sessions and co-writing for other artists, adds another layer of earnings. Publishing income from these projects can deliver long-tail returns long after the initial collaboration.
